Hydrovisions,
Inc. (HV) sells its Raptor designs and accessories through a network of
Sales Agents. It does not sell through stocking distributors or dealers.
HV Sales Agents purchase their boat at full retail price but qualify for
a $1,000 rebate when they sell their first four boats. The rebate is paid
in four equal installments of $250 each. In addition, Sales Agents earn
a 7% commission on all boats sold. Sales Agents are given exclusive rights
to solicit orders in a geographically limited Sales Region. HV Sales Agents
must attach a sticker with Hydrovisions’ web site address on the
sail of their own boat and must agree to take their boat to the most popular
beaches and launch sites in their Sales Region on weekends and holidays
and give prospective purchasers the opportunity to sail and/or paddle
the boat.
Orders
for boats are placed directly with HV by purchasers via the internet.
Boats can be picked up by customers at HV’s assembly facility in
Vista, California or drop shipped, freight prepaid, directly to customers.
HV Sales Agents are paid a commission on sales to all purchasers whose
orders resulted from a demonstration sail or paddle provided by an HV
Sales Agent within his/her Sales Region.
HV Sales Agents are independent contractors and not employees of HV. They
own their demonstration boat(s) and are responsible for:
a) instructing prospective purchasers of the Raptor in the safe operation
of the boat,
b) insuring that the prospective purchaser is competent to take the boat
out in the prevailing conditions at the time of the demonstration, and
c) insuring that the prospective purchaser is a competent swimmer and
wears a personal floatation device. They must sign an independent contractor
agreement with HV that contains, among other provisions, indemnification
and hold harmless provisions covering the foregoing responsibilities.
